So we got up early this morning and got al the chores done so I could get out and run. The plan was to just go as long as I could (within reason).

The first 10kms were fine. I was running well, and felt pretty good. The second 10kms were quite hot and I was starting to struggle a bit by the time I entered the third loop.

That’s when things started to really hurt. It wasn’t so much the running, but the heat. It just got hotter and hotter. My heart rate was over 140 bpm when I was just walking!

I struggled on determined to do at least one more circuit. But it was becoming quite clear that it was too hot for me to be running. I was overheating even after dousing myself with cold water. There was a risk that if I kept going I get heatstroke.

Heatstroke is not the most fun you can have, so I decided to quit on the third loop and head for home.

It was disappointing not to get more miles under my belt, but I think continuing would have been stupid (and I’m good at being stupid).

I think I’m going to have to start running early in the morning again to avoid the heat of the day. Who would have thought such a thing would ever be necessary in New Zealand?
